Social Minister Tri Rismaharini is running as a prospective gubernatorial candidate in the 2024 East Java Regional Elections, supported by the Indonesian Democratic Party of Struggle (PDIP) and the Hanura Party.
According to a Kompas Research and Development (Litbang) survey, Risma, as she is popularly known, enjoys a fairly positive image among the public.
A majority, or 44.6%, of respondents in East Java consider Risma's main strength to be her performance or experience in leadership.
"During her two terms as Mayor of Surabaya (2010-2020), Risma demonstrated tangible changes in the city as a result of her leadership," stated the Kompas Litbang team in their report on Friday, August 30, 2024.
Furthermore, Risma's down-to-earth and authoritative character is considered an asset by 39.9% of respondents. This is followed by her decisive or courageous nature, which was cited as a positive attribute by 2.2% of respondents.
Some respondents also viewed Risma's strengths based on her identity as a local daughter, her kindness, and honesty, each with a proportion of 0.6%.
Meanwhile, 10.9% of respondents did not know or did not answer regarding the former Surabaya Mayor's strengths.
This Kompas Litbang survey involved 500 respondents randomly selected using a stratified systematic sampling method in East Java province.
Data collection was conducted from June 20-25, 2024, through face-to-face interviews. The survey's margin of error is approximately 4.38%, with a 95% confidence level, under conditions of simple random sampling.
